A map shows the distance between the corner of cactus road and 1st street and the corner of 1 St Street and Merle road as 3 inch

es. If the scale is 1 in. : 3.7 mi, what is the actual distance?

11.1 miles 

1in / 3.7 m = 3 in / 11.1 m
